Tom Taylor - December 3, 2017

Last night, in the main event of the action-packed UFC 218, UFC featherweight champion Max Holloway made the first successful defense of his title, taking out featherweight great Jose Aldo with third-round punches. With this win, Holloway extended his current streak to a whopping 12-straight. The Hawaiian’s last loss occurred back in August of 2013, when he was out-hustled by Conor McGregor. Shortly after Holloway’s UFC 218 win, McGregor took to Twitter to remind him of this fact.

Tom Taylor - December 3, 2017

Last night, in the main event of the stacked UFC 218, UFC featherweight champ Max Holloway defended his title for the first time, authoring a second consecutive win over featherweight great Jose Aldo. While this was a fantastic victory for Holloway, he did appear to endure a pretty rough cut down to the featherweight division’s 145-pound limit. Speaking at the UFC 218 post-fight press conference, the champ acknowledged this rough cut, and admitted that we could see him win titles in heavier divisions in the future. In fact, he hopes to win titles in many, many of the UFC’s toughest divisions.

UFC 218 Results: Felice Herrig defeats Cortney Casey

Chris Taylor - December 2, 2017

A key women’s strawweight fight between Cortney Casey and Felice Herrig kicked off tonight’s UFC 218 prelims on FS1. Round one begins and Herrig comes out quickly. She is trying to close the distance on Casey. Cortney lands a nice combination that ends in a leg kick. Both women seem cool with trading leather early. Casey is countering well early. She lands a nice combination that ends in an overhand right. Herrig paws with her jab. She throws a leg kick that lands. Casey with a right hand but she gets countered beautifully be Herrig. Casey returns fire with a combination that lands. Herrig presses forward and pushes Casey up against the cage. She is able to drag Cortney to the floor and immediately moves to half guard. Casey is doing a good job of defending here. She attempts a kimura and uses the submission to escape and get back up to her feet. Herrig with a jab to the body followed by a low kick. Casey and Herrig trade bombs to end round one.
